Hello, we have Ultra3000i drive(2098-DSD-HV050X-DN) with motor allen-bradley (MPL-B4540F-M) and smart encoder, indexing mode.
We had defect at drive, so we backup drive setup and after repair, we upload setup back.

Now when i set "Drive enable" (from PLC or Ultraware), motor starts moving really fast in reverse without reason and then stops with ERROR E24 (Velocity excess error).
I tried motor test from "Velocity control panel", but no change. Test in "Indexing control panel" is little different. Motor makes only 1 revolution in reverse (ignoring indexing setup) and stops with error E19 - Excess position error.
I tried reset to factory settings, change inputs to only hardware, disable/enable all inputs, etc. etc.. I don't see any instruction to move.
Motor moves normally only in "Current control setup". There i can move forward or reverse.
I tried another same drive(in bad condition), upload setup, and when i set "Drive enable" the same problem appeared.
I can't even get 1 required move.
Encoder sending about 300 000 pulses per revolution to drive and seems working properly (motor feedback test is ok).

Does anyone here has any idea, what can cause this?
Thx for anything.
 
Oh my god. Problem was really on encoder. My workmate screwed the encoder incorectly (weak pressure to motor shaft). Thank you.
